Yes, overseeding can help improve your lawn's resilience against diseases. By introducing new, healthy grass varieties through overseeding, you can increase the diversity of your lawn, making it less susceptible to pests and diseases. In Odenton, where certain lawn diseases may be prevalent due to humidity and temperature variations, overseeding with disease-resistant grass types can fortify your lawn. It helps fill in thin areas where diseases are more likely to take hold and creates a stronger, more vigorous lawn overall. However, it's also important to maintain proper lawn care practices, such as adequate watering and fertilization, to minimize disease risks.
Preparing your lawn for overseeding is crucial for successful germination and growth. Begin by mowing your existing grass to a lower height to ensure that sunlight reaches the soil. Then, dethatch your lawn to remove any dead grass and debris that can impede seed contact with the soil. In Odenton, where soil may compact over time, aerating the lawn can help improve seed-to-soil contact and increase airflow. After aerating, spread the overseed evenly across the lawn, preferably using a broadcast spreader for uniform coverage. Finally, water the area thoroughly to help the seeds settle and promote germination.
After overseeding, it's essential to keep the soil consistently moist to encourage seed germination. In Odenton, you should water lightly once or twice daily for the first couple of weeks. This frequent watering helps the seeds establish roots without washing them away. As the grass begins to grow and establishes itself, you can gradually reduce the frequency of watering. Aim for deeper watering sessions every few days rather than shallow, frequent watering. This promotes deeper root growth, which is vital for a healthy lawn. Monitor the moisture level of the soil and adjust your watering schedule based on weather conditions.
Overseeding and reseeding are different processes that serve to improve the health of your lawn. Overseeding involves spreading new grass seed over existing grass to fill in thin areas and improve density without tearing up the old lawn. This process is particularly beneficial in Odenton's climate, as it helps maintain a lush green lawn during the growing season. Reseeding, on the other hand, involves completely removing the old grass and planting new seeds. This is usually done when the existing lawn is severely damaged or dead. Choosing the right method depends on the current condition of your lawn and your long-term lawn care strategy.
The optimal time for overseeding in Odenton is during the early fall, typically from late August to mid-September. This timing allows the new seeds to establish roots before the colder winter months. The cool temperatures and increased rainfall during this period create ideal conditions for seed germination and growth. Additionally, overseeding in the fall helps to thicken the lawn, making it more resilient against winter stress and springtime weeds. If you miss the fall window, early spring can also be a suitable time, but be cautious of potential weed competition as temperatures rise.
